Understanding Mechanical Desktop Ultrasonic Cleaners
Mechanical Desktop Ultrasonic Cleaners operate by emitting high-frequency sound waves through a liquid. This process generates microscopic bubbles that implode, creating a scrubbing effect on surfaces. This technology is particularly effective for cleaning intricate components that might be damaged by traditional cleaning methods. The specific parameters such as frequency, tank capacity, and power output are crucial when selecting a cleaner suited for particular laboratory tasks.

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them
Selecting the wrong ultrasonic cleaner can lead to inefficiency and damage to delicate items. One common mistake is neglecting to consider the frequency and power requirements of the cleaning task. Higher frequencies are suited for delicate items, while lower frequencies are better for heavy-duty cleaning. Why is the frequency important in ultrasonic cleaning?
The frequency is vital in ultrasonic cleaning as it determines the cavitation bubble size and cleaning power. Higher frequencies, like those found in the YR05203 model (up to 120 kHz), provide a gentler cleaning action, ideal for delicate items, while lower frequencies are better for robust cleaning tasks.
